要在 tomcat 中运行 class 文件,需要依次执行以下步骤:编译 class 文件。将 class 文件复制到 WEB-INF/classes 目录。在 web.xml 文件中添加 servlet 元素。在 context.xml 文件中添加 Context 元素。重启 tomcat。通过浏览器访问 servlet。

如何运行 tomcat 中的 class 文件
在 tomcat 中运行 class 文件需要以下步骤:
1. 编译 class 文件
使用 Java 编译器(例如 javac)将 Java 源文件 (.java) 编译为字节码文件 (.class)。
2. 将 class 文件复制到 WEB-INF/classes 目录
将编译后的 class 文件复制到 tomcat 的 WEB-INF/classes 目录中。该目录位于 tomcat 的 webapps 目录下的应用程序的根目录中。
3. 修改 web.xml 文件
在 WEB-INF/web.xml 文件中添加 <servlet> 元素,如下所示:
<code class="xml"><servlet> <servlet-name>MyServlet</servlet-name> <servlet-class>com.example.MyServlet</servlet-class> </servlet></code>
其中,<servlet-name> 是 servlet 的名称,<servlet-class> 是 servlet 的完全限定类名。
本文档主要讲述的是Android无缝替换Dalvik虚拟机;Dalvik虚拟机实则也算是一个Java虚拟机,只不过它执行的不是class文件,而是dex文件。因此,ART运行时最理想的方式也是实现为一个Java虚拟机的形式,这样就可以很容易地将Dalvik虚拟机替换掉。希望本文档会给有需要的朋友带来帮助;感兴趣的朋友可以过来看看
0
4. 修改 context.xml 文件
在 conf/context.xml 文件中添加 <Context> 元素,如下所示:
<code class="xml"><Context> <WatchedResource>WEB-INF/classes</WatchedResource> </Context></code>
这将告诉 tomcat 监视 WEB-INF/classes 目录并重新加载任何更改的 class 文件。
5. 重启 tomcat
重启 tomcat 以加载更改。
6. 访问 servlet
通过在浏览器中输入以下 URL 访问 servlet:
<code>http://localhost:8080/<应用程序名称>/<servlet 路径></code>
其中,<应用程序名称> 是应用程序的名称,<servlet 路径> 是 servlet 的映射路径。
以上就是tomcat怎么运行class文件的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号